Hundeyin said: 'The corpse has been deposited in the mortuary for autopsy and preservation. An investigation is ongoing.' The incident reportedly happened on Thursday while a forklift was lifting armoured cable drums.
'Incidentally, one of the cable drums disconnected and fell on a passerby, who was said to be pressing his phone while walking, and he gave up the ghost on the way to hospital. The scene was visited by detectives of the Ilemba-Hausa division, and inquiries were made,' a police source disclosed. Meanwhile, the company's owner has been taken into custody for questioning.
